FEC is a global property development company specialising in homes for open market sale that aims to create high quality residential developments and hotels across London, Manchester and other key cities across the UK. The company’s proven 50-year track record has resulted in the development of over 200 million sq ft. of residential and hotel space throughout the Asia-Pacific region. The company’s global portfolio is valued at over £4.8 billion, of which £1.1 billion is contributed to its UK projects. The company has several mixed-use developments in the pipeline across Manchester and London and will play a key role in the regeneration of Manchester’s Victoria North, one of the largest regeneration projects in the UK.
